The surname Churchill has a long and storied history that dates back centuries. It is believed to have originated in England, where it was derived from a place name. The name Churchill comes from the Old English words "cyrc," meaning "church," and "hyll," meaning "hill." This suggests that the name was originally used to describe someone who lived near a church on a hill.
